Martinique Fisherman Goes Missing In The Saint Lucia Channel

A search and rescue operation has been underway since Sunday afternoon after a Martinique fisherman fell into the waters of the Saint Lucia Channel.
The Channel is a strait separating Martinique to the north and Saint Lucia to the south.
The circumstances surrounding the disappearance of the Martinique fisherman were not immediately clear.
However, a release from Martinique’s Prefect disclosed that the Antilles-Guyana Regional Operational Surveillance and Rescue Center (Marine Directorate) learned of the incident at 1:05 p.m.
The information triggered a massive air and sea search and rescue operation that included helicopters and privately owned boats.
The search continued on Monday.
